Kamanda Mahadev or Kamadeshwar Mandir (Hindi: कामंदा महादेव / काम्देश्वर महादेव) is one of the temples of Lord Shiva, located at a distance of 2 kilometres north of Satpuli in the Pauri Garhwal district of Uttarakhand, India.
